Follow the steps to fill out the IRS 1065 - Schedule K-1 online
- Click the ‘Get Form’ button to access the IRS 1065 - Schedule K-1 and open it in your preferred editor.
- Identify the basic information required for Part I of the form. This includes providing the partnership’s name, address, and Employer Identification Number (EIN). Make sure these details are accurate and match the partnership's records.
- In Part II, enter the individual partner's information. This section will require the partner's name, address, and identifying number, which can be their Social Security Number (SSN) or EIN if applicable.
- Proceed to Part III to report the specific share of income, deductions, credits, etc., attributable to each partner. Input the relevant figures from the partnership's operating agreement or financial records, ensuring all numbers are correctly calculated.
- Review the information entered in all sections of the form for accuracy. Make any necessary adjustments before finalizing the form.

Who fills out Schedule K-1 form 1065?
The partnership itself is responsible for filling out IRS Schedule K-1 Form 1065. The partnership must report all income, deductions, and credits allocated to each partner. This form is crucial for the partners to report their share of the partnership's income correctly on their own tax returns, ensuring compliance and accurate tax payments.

What happens if I don't file form 1065?
If you fail to file IRS Form 1065 on time, you may face significant penalties. The IRS penalizes partnerships for not filing, and these fines increase for each month it's late. Additionally, not filing can delay tax processing and may complicate income reporting for partners who need their Schedule K-1 forms. What is Schedule K-1 form 1065 for?
Schedule K-1 Form 1065 is used to report each partner's share of the partnership's earnings, losses, and tax credits. It ensures that income from partnerships is accurately reflected in partners' individual tax returns. Understanding this form is key to meeting your tax obligations.
